Northwest Told to Limit Foreign Equity: Northwest Airlines said the Transportation Department told it that despite new rules relaxing restrictions on foreign ownership, it must either place some of its foreign-owned equity in a trust or sell it. A Northwest spokesman said KLM Royal Dutch Airlines and the Australian conglomerate ELders IXL together own 68% of Northwest’s equity. In saying Wednesday that foreigners may own up to 49%, the department freed Northwest from a previous requirement that it redeem $250 million in KLM stock held in a trust.
